Example - The earthquake-proof skyscraper.

In earthquake areas such as Tokyo it has been discovered that skyscrapers should not be built too rigid, if they are to withstand severe earthquakes. It is better to build structures capable of oscillation and to provide adequate damping. By setting up the response of a skyscraper to an earthquake as the solution to a set of coupled oscillators, using methods developed above we can simulate the behaviour of a multistory building during an earthquake.
